Light and sound

This week was very rainy, it showed clearly there was one leak left. You’d say it would be easy to fix that last roof, but it turned out to be tricky. Because after I put another wider layer of repair material there was still a little water coming in. In the mean time Mo filled the last seams between the tiles in the hallway. And together with Mo and Marc we put in the last parts of the roof insulation during the week.
In the weekend ABC had another 25% discount and with the shortening days we found out the back yard was pretty dark, so I got some LED spot lights and some motion detectors. The weird thing was that a halogen spotlight including a motion detector was cheaper then just the motion detector, but since I did not have a use for the halogen spotlights I decided to earn back the difference while using the spotlights.
Besides I wanted to install a doorbell, after looking around I found a doorbell with two different sounds depending on the button you press. So I installed one at the front door and one at the back door. Very interesting to see almost all doorbells in Estonia work on 230V up to the button.
